Bacon-Garlic Chicken Breasts

30-60 minutes
ingredients
1/4 cup butter or margarine
1 clove garlic, minced
2 teaspoons dried parsley flakes
1 teaspoon grated lemon rind
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/8 teaspoon hot pepper sauce
2 whole chicken breasts (1 lb. each), halved
4 slices bacon, cut in half
directions
Place butter and garlic in 12 x 7-inch baking dish. Microwave for about 1 minute on High or until garlic is partly cooked. Add remaining ingredients, except chicken breasts and bacon; mix well.
Roll chicken breasts in seasoned butter; arrange skin side up and thick edges toward outside in buttered baking dish. Lay 2 half-slices of bacon on each chicken breast.
Cover dish with waxed paper. Microwave for 14 to 18 minutes on High or until meat is no longer pink in center. Let stand about 5 minutes before serving.
